Ingredients You’ll Need
The ingredient list for Pepperoni Pizza Grilled Cheese is charmingly short, but every detail matters. Each item is here for a reason—bringing you that magical blend of cheesy comfort and nostalgic pizzeria flavor with barely any effort.
- Sourdough or Sandwich Bread: Go with a sturdy loaf to hold all those glorious fillings. Sourdough adds a lovely tang, but any favorite bread works!
- Butter (softened): This gives your sandwich maximum crispness and golden color once toasted; don’t skip the butter on the outside!
- Pizza Sauce: For that unmistakable pizza flavor, a good pizza sauce is essential. If you’re out, marinara is a trusty backup.
- Shredded Mozzarella Cheese: The star of the cheese pull! Mozzarella melts perfectly, but feel free to mix in some provolone for extra depth.
- Pepperoni Slices: Give you that classic, meaty punch—layer them generously for best results.
- Grated Parmesan Cheese (optional): Adds a salty, nutty boost on top of the mozzarella for serious pizza vibes.
- Italian Seasoning or Dried Oregano: Just a pinch brings everything together, adding that signature herb aroma you love from your favorite slice.
How to Make Pepperoni Pizza Grilled Cheese
Step 1: Butter the Bread
Grab your bread slices and spread a generous layer of softened butter on one side of each. This buttery coating is what crisps up and turns beautifully golden in the skillet, so don’t hold back!
Step 2: Assemble the Sandwich
Place one slice of bread, buttered side down, into a cold nonstick skillet. Smear the top with pizza sauce, spreading it edge to edge. Pile on the shredded mozzarella, making sure it goes right to the corners, then layer your pepperoni slices over the cheese. Sprinkle with Parmesan if using, plus a pinch of Italian seasoning and oregano for that irresistible pizzeria flavor. Top with the second slice of bread, buttered side facing up.
Step 3: Cook to Golden Perfection
Turn the heat to medium and let the sandwich toast. After about 3–4 minutes, when the bottom is crisp and deep golden, carefully flip with a spatula. Press gently and cook for another 3–4 minutes until the other side is just as perfect and the cheese is gooey and molten inside.
Step 4: Slice and Serve
Remove the Pepperoni Pizza Grilled Cheese from the pan, let it sit for a minute to avoid a lava-cheese situation, then slice it in half. Serve hot while the cheese is fabulously stretchy!

Make Ahead and Storage
Storing Leftovers
If you have any leftovers (which is rare!), wrap them tightly in foil or store in an airtight container in the fridge for up to 2 days. The bread may lose some crispness, but the flavors will still shine.
Freezing
You can freeze cooked, fully cooled Pepperoni Pizza Grilled Cheese sandwiches! Wrap individually in parchment or plastic wrap, then in foil, and store in a freezer bag for up to one month. Thaw before reheating for the best texture.
Reheating
To bring back that fresh-toasted vibe, reheat your sandwich in a toaster oven or skillet over low heat until warmed through and crisp again. Microwaving works in a pinch but won’t deliver that crunchy crust; add a quick skillet finish if you have time.
FAQs
Can I use different bread for Pepperoni Pizza Grilled Cheese?
Absolutely! Sourdough is classic for its sturdy texture, but any hearty sliced bread works—think Italian, ciabatta, or even a multigrain slice if you love a bit of chew.
What cheeses melt best for this sandwich?
Mozzarella is the go-to for that dreamy pizza pull, but you can combine it with provolone, fontina, or even a little sharp cheddar for extra flavor, as long as they melt well!
Can I make this vegetarian?
Definitely! Just skip the pepperoni and add your favorite veggies, like sliced mushrooms, peppers, or olives. Roasted veggies work especially well for extra pizza flair.
Can I make more than one Pepperoni Pizza Grilled Cheese at once?
Yes—just use a larger skillet or griddle to make multiple sandwiches side by side. Keep finished sandwiches warm in a low oven if you’re serving a crowd.
Is there a way to make it a bit healthier?
Swap to whole-grain bread, use part-skim mozzarella, and add veggies inside for extra nutrients. You can even lightly brush the bread with olive oil instead of butter for a lighter twist.

Pepperoni Pizza Grilled Cheese Recipe
- Total Time: 13 minutes
- Yield: 1 sandwich 1x
- Diet: Non-Vegetarian
Description
This Pepperoni Pizza Grilled Cheese recipe combines the flavors of a classic pepperoni pizza with the comfort of a grilled cheese sandwich. It’s a quick and easy meal that’s perfect for lunch or a simple dinner.
Ingredients
Bread:
- 2 slices sourdough or sandwich bread
Butter:
- 1 tablespoon butter (softened)
Pizza Sauce:
- 2 tablespoons pizza sauce
Cheese:
- 1/3 cup shredded mozzarella cheese
Pepperoni:
- 6–8 slices pepperoni
Parmesan Cheese:
- 1 tablespoon grated Parmesan cheese (optional)
Seasoning:
- Pinch of Italian seasoning or dried oregano
Instructions
- Spread Butter: Spread butter on one side of each bread slice.
- Layer Ingredients: Lay one slice, buttered side down, in a skillet over medium heat. Spread pizza sauce over the top, then layer with mozzarella cheese, pepperoni slices, Parmesan cheese if using, and a pinch of Italian seasoning. Top with the second slice of bread, buttered side up.
- Cook: Cook for 3–4 minutes per side, pressing gently with a spatula, until the bread is golden and the cheese is melted. Slice and serve hot.
Notes
- Add sautéed mushrooms, green peppers, or olives for extra pizza flavor.
- Use marinara sauce if pizza sauce isn’t available.
- Prep Time: 5 minutes
- Cook Time: 8 minutes
- Category: Main Course
- Method: Stovetop
- Cuisine: American
